The Anatomy of a Cabinet Sign
At its core, a cabinet sign is a self-contained box, which is why you’ll sometimes hear them called "box signs" or "lightboxes." The structure is typically built from durable, rust-proof aluminum to create the outer cabinet or frame. The front face, where your branding lives, is made from a tough, translucent material like acrylic or polycarbonate. Your logo, business name, and other graphics are then applied to this face. This construction makes for incredibly durable business signs that are engineered to withstand the elements for years to come, protecting your investment and keeping your brand looking sharp.

Classic and Bright: Fluorescent Signs
While LED has become the industry standard, fluorescent lighting is another option for illuminating cabinet signs. For years, these bulbs were the primary way to light up signs, offering a familiar, bright glow that gets the job done. This can be a consideration for businesses looking to match existing signage or for specific budget requirements. However, fluorescent bulbs generally have a shorter lifespan and use more energy than their LED counterparts. How Size and Materials Affect Price
The most straightforward factors in your sign’s cost are its size and the materials used to build it. A larger sign requires more raw materials like aluminum and acrylic, as well as more labor to fabricate, which naturally increases the price. As a general starting point, many lighted cabinet signs fall in the range of $1,500 to $5,000, but this can shift significantly. For example, a large, double-sided sign designed to be seen from both directions will cost more than a smaller, single-sided one mounted flat against a wall. The type of materials you choose for your business signs also plays a role, from the durability of the frame to the type of plastic used for the face.

Factoring in Installation and Permits
The cost of a cabinet sign doesn’t end once it’s built. Professional installation and the necessary permits are critical parts of the budget that you shouldn't overlook. Most cities and counties require permits for new illuminated signs to ensure they meet safety and zoning codes. A full-service sign partner can manage this entire process for you. The actual sign installation may require specialized equipment, like a crane or bucket truck, along with licensed electricians to handle the wiring. The site conditions, like the height of the installation and accessibility, also affect the labor and equipment needed to get the job done right.
